Tessia Bennington is relieved to spend the Christmas holidays at the Blackmoor Inn with her elderly aunt and uncle and their friends. The invitation offers an escape from her family's constant urging for her to consider other suitors. The man she'd expected to marry begged off after hearing of her meager dowry. She has no desire to be drawn into another fated relationship. Once settled at the inn, she shrugs off their handsome host's advances, but when she senses a ghostly presence in need of her help, she can't refuse.

Damien Reeves grudgingly agrees to take over as host for his ailing uncle's Christmas party. Since Damien's family's horrific tragedy two years earlier, holidays hold only painful memories for him. The event, held at a country inn famous for absurd ghost lore, promises to be a tedious few days, even with his uncle's request that he try to solve a mystery of petty thefts that have occurred among his guests over the past year. When an enticing young woman arrives at the inn. Damien begins to think it might not be as dreadful a holiday as he'd predicted.

Neither Tess nor Damien could have imagined the outcome of their holiday—the bizarre events, the frolicking escapades of the aged partiers, or the thieving culprit's tenacity. Will they part with memories of an unforgettable Christmas or shed their defenses and find happiness in each other?
